Responsibilities as a Recruitment Administrator

Using job boards & other methods to attract direct applicants.
Post job adverts on our sector job boards.
Develop relationships with local universities and use their job boards to develop a direct stream of candidates.
Make recommendations for improving our attraction methods.
Assist in identifying potential candidates from internal sources such as employee referrals and internal talent pools.
Screen incoming applications and forward qualified candidates to OMPs for review.
Maintain accurate records of candidate applications and correspondence.
Schedule interviews between candidates and hiring managers.
Coordinate interview logistics, including booking meeting rooms and arranging Teams or telephone interviews as necessary.
Communicate interview details and provide support to candidates throughout the process.
Liaise with candidates, responding to enquiries and providing updates on their application status.
Coordinate feedback and provide timely updates to candidates.
Ensure a positive candidate experience by delivering clear, consistent, and professional communication.
Maintain accurate and up-to-date records in the recruitment tracking system.
Take responsibility for co-ordinating work experience placements, liaising with HR.
